Streamlining Zimbra Migrations with Automation
Moving your email environment to Zimbra presents unique challenges, but the suitable tools and automation strategies can make the transition seamless. A comprehensive migration toolkit often includes features like data import wizards, server synchronization utilities, and configuration tools. By leveraging these resources, you can efficiently transfer user mailboxes, calendars, contacts, and other critical data. Automation plays a crucial part in minimizing downtime and ensuring a smooth transition for your users. Consider implementing automated processes for tasks such as account provisioning, email forwarding, and mailbox migration verification. By embracing automation, you can reduce manual effort, minimize errors, and ensure a successful Zimbra migration.
